供应链中台管理系统是企业为了提高供应链管理效率、降低成本、提升服务质量而建立的一套综合性管理系统。它主要包括以下几个部分构成要素:
1. 数据层:这是供应链中台管理系统的基础,包括各类数据的收集、存储和处理。数据层的主要任务是确保供应链中的各种信息能够准确、及时地被收集和处理,为上层应用提供支持。数据层通常采用数据库技术,如关系型数据库、NoSQL数据库等。
2. 业务逻辑层:这是供应链中台管理系统的核心,负责处理各种业务流程。业务逻辑层的主要任务是根据企业的业务需求,设计并实现各种业务流程,如采购、库存管理、订单处理、物流配送等。业务逻辑层通常采用面向对象编程技术,如Java、Python等。
3. 应用服务层:这是供应链中台管理系统的前台,负责为用户提供各种服务。应用服务层的主要任务是根据业务逻辑层的需求,设计并实现各种应用服务,如订单查询、库存查询、报表生成等。应用服务层通常采用Web开发技术,如HTML、CSS、JavaScript、PHP、Python等。
4. 用户界面层:这是供应链中台管理系统的前端,负责与用户进行交互。用户界面层的主要任务是根据业务逻辑层的需求,设计并实现各种用户界面,如网页、移动应用等。用户界面层通常采用Web开发技术,如HTML、CSS、JavaScript、React、Vue等。
5. 安全层:这是供应链中台管理系统的安全保障,负责保护系统免受外部攻击和内部滥用。安全层的主要任务是实现系统的身份验证、权限控制、数据加密等安全功能。安全层通常采用网络安全技术,如防火墙、入侵检测系统、数据加密算法等。
6. 集成层:这是供应链中台管理系统与其他系统的连接桥梁,负责实现系统之间的数据交换和业务协同。集成层的主要任务是实现系统之间的接口定义、数据传输协议、数据格式转换等功能。集成层通常采用中间件技术,如消息队列、事件总线、API网关等。
7. 运维层:这是供应链中台管理系统的后台支持,负责系统的日常维护和故障处理。运维层的主要任务是监控系统运行状态、备份数据、恢复系统、处理异常情况等。运维层通常采用自动化运维工具,如Ansible、Puppet、Chef等。
8. 云平台层:这是供应链中台管理系统的基础设施,负责提供计算资源、存储资源、网络资源等。云平台层的主要任务是实现资源的弹性伸缩、负载均衡、容灾备份等功能。云平台层通常采用云计算技术,如公有云、私有云、混合云等。